Springily is an adverb.
The adverb is an invariable part of the sentence that can change, explain or simplify a verb or another adverb.

WHAT DOES SPRINGILY M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Definition of springily in the English dictionary

The definition of springily in the dictionary is in a manner characterized by resilience or bounce.
